Choosing the best casting method for a particular application can be a complex decision that involves considering multiple factors such as material properties, complexité en partie, volume de production, et coûter. In this article, we will explore various casting methods, their advantages, and the criteria for selecting the most suitable one for a given project.
1. Introduction to Casting Methods
Casting is a manufacturing process that involves pouring a liquid material, typically metal, into a mold to form a solid object. Il existe plusieurs types de méthodes de coulée, each with its own unique characteristics and suitability for different applications.
2. Types of Casting Methods
Here are some of the most common casting methods:
- Coulée de sable: This method uses sand as the mold material. It is versatile and can be used to produce a wide range of part sizes and shapes. Sand casting is cost-effective for low to medium production volumes and is suitable for materials like iron, acier, aluminium, et bronze.
- Moulage: En casting de dé, the mold is made of metal and is used to produce high-precision parts in large quantities. This method is particularly suitable for materials like aluminum, zinc, et magnésium. Die casting offers excellent dimensional accuracy and surface finish, but the initial investment in molding tools can be high.
- Casting d'investissement (Lost-Wax Casting): This method involves creating a wax pattern of the part, coating it with a ceramic material, and then melting out the wax to create a mold cavity. Investment casting is used for producing high-precision parts with complex geometries, such as those found in the aerospace and jewelry industries.
- Casting centrifuge: This method involves rotating the mold at high speeds while pouring in the molten material. It results in a more uniform distribution of material and improved mechanical properties, making it suitable for producing cylindrical parts like pipes and tubes.
- Permanent Mold Casting: This method uses reusable metal molds, which offer better dimensional accuracy and surface finish than sand casting but are less expensive than die casting. It is suitable for materials like aluminum and magnesium.
3. Criteria for Selecting the Best Casting Method
Choosing the best casting method involves considering several factors:
- Propriétés des matériaux: Different casting methods are better suited for different materials. Par exemple, die casting is well-suited for aluminum, while sand casting is versatile and can be used for a variety of materials.
- Part Complexity: The complexity of the part plays a significant role in selecting the casting method. Investment casting is ideal for parts with complex geometries, while sand casting is better suited for simpler shapes.
- Volume de production: The volume of parts to be produced affects the choice of casting method. Die casting is ideal for high-volume production, while sand casting is more cost-effective for lower volumes.
- Coût: The initial investment in molding tools and equipment, as well as the cost per part, should be considered. Sand casting is generally more cost-effective for low to medium production volumes, while die casting offers lower costs per part for high-volume production.
- Précision dimensionnelle et finition de surface: The required dimensional accuracy and surface finish of the part are also important factors. Die casting and investment casting offer excellent dimensional accuracy and surface finish, while sand casting may require additional machining to achieve the desired quality.
4. Advantages and Disadvantages of Different Casting Methods
- Coulée de sable:
- Avantages: Polyvalent, suitable for a wide range of materials, and cost-effective for low to medium production volumes.
- Désavantage: Lower dimensional accuracy and surface finish compared to other methods.
- Moulage:
- Avantages: High production volumes, excellent dimensional accuracy and surface finish, and suitable for materials like aluminum.
- Désavantage: High initial investment in molding tools, limited to non-ferrous metals, and not suitable for very large parts.
- Casting d'investissement:
- Avantages: High precision and suitable for complex geometries, suitable for a variety of materials.
- Désavantage: High cost and longer lead times compared to other methods.
- Casting centrifuge:
- Avantages: Suitable for cylindrical parts, uniform material distribution, and improved mechanical properties.
- Désavantage: Limited to specific shapes and materials.
- Permanent Mold Casting:
- Avantages: Better dimensional accuracy and surface finish than sand casting, reusable molds, and suitable for materials like aluminum and magnesium.
- Désavantage: Higher initial investment in molds compared to sand casting.
5. Conclusion
Ultimately, the best casting method depends on the specific requirements of the project. By considering factors such as material properties, complexité en partie, volume de production, coût, and dimensional accuracy, manufacturers can select the most suitable casting method for their application. It is important to consult with casting experts and evaluate multiple options to ensure that the chosen method meets all project requirements and delivers the desired results.
